Mapping and monitoring the global burden of antimicrobial-resistance/drug-resistant infections
In plain English
AI plain-English summaryDoctors and public health officials cannot say with certainty how many people are dying from drug-resistant infections, or where the worst hotspots are. This project aims to fix that by pulling together scattered data from hospitals, labs, and health records around the world into a single, rigorous global picture. Antimicrobial resistance has been recognised as a threat for decades, but the information about its true geographical spread and prevalence remains surprisingly poor. Without reliable numbers on how many infections are drug-resistant, where they occur, and how this has changed over time, it is impossible to measure the problem accurately or to know which interventions are working. This project fills that gap by incorporating drug-resistant infections into the Global Burden of Disease Study, the standard framework used to track health trends worldwide. If successful, the research will produce interactive maps and visualisations showing the burden of resistance over time, openly accessible to anyone. This would give governments, hospitals, and funding agencies a concrete benchmark to measure whether their efforts to combat resistance are actually reducing deaths and illness. It would also reveal where resources are most urgently needed, turning a vague global threat into a measurable, manageable problem.
